22 package org.continuent.sequoia.common.jmx;
23
24 import javax.management.remote.JMXPrincipal JavaDoc;
25
26 /**
27  * A <code>JMXPrincipalWithPassword</code> extends <code>JMXPrincipal</code>
28  * by adding a (<code>Serializable</code>) <code>password</code> to it.
29  */

30 public class JMXPrincipalWithPassword extends JMXPrincipal JavaDoc
31 {
32   private static final long serialVersionUID = 2398461471450955078L;
33   private String JavaDoc password;
34
35   /**
36    * Creates a new <code>JMXPrincipalWithPassword</code> object based on the
37    * <code>name</code> and <code>password</code>.<br />
38    * <code>name</code> and <code>password</code> must not be
39    * <code>null</code>.
40    *
41    * @param name name of the principal
42    * @param password password of the principal to use for authentication
43    * @see JMXPrincipal#JMXPrincipal(String)
44    */

45   public JMXPrincipalWithPassword(String JavaDoc name, String JavaDoc password)
46   {
47     super(name);
48     this.password = password;
49   }
50
51   /**
52    * Returns the password associated to this Principal
53    *
54    * @return Principal password
55    */

56   public String JavaDoc getPassword()
57   {
58     return password;
59   }
60 }
